当前位置: 代码迷 >> Oracle管理 >> 初学者求指导SQL如何写
  详细解决方案

初学者求指导SQL如何写

热度:123   发布时间:2016-04-24 04:13:22.0
菜鸟求指导SQL怎么写
要求:(1)当前时间 > 10号,统计周期:当月10号到下月10号;
            (2)当前时间 < 10号,统计周期:上月10号到本月10号;
            (3)按照table_type和import_date分类统计


表结构如下:
TABLE_ID            NUMBER(20) 表ID
TABLE_NAME     VARCHAR2(40) 表名称
TABLE_DES       VARCHAR2(40) 表描述
TABLE_TYPE     VARCHAR2(40) 所属分类
IMPORT_DATE  DATE 导入报表时间

------解决思路----------------------
select table_type,import_date,count(1)
from T
WHERE TRUNC(IMPORT_DATE-10,'MONTH')=TRUNC(SYSDATE-10,'MONTH')
GROUP BY  table_type,import_date
  相关解决方案